Abstract

The invention provides a welding positioning device used for a short pipe flange. The welding positioning device comprises a bracket and a clamp arranged on the bracket, wherein the bracket comprises pedestal; a rotary shaft is arranged on the pedestal; a first rotary plate used for positioning a to-be-welded short pipe pipeline and a second rotary plate used for positioning the clamp are arranged on the rotary shaft; the first rotary plate and the second rotary plate synchronously rotate along with the rotary shaft, and are adjustable in height on the rotary shaft; the clamp comprises a pipeline clamp used for clamping the short pipe pipeline, and a first flange and a second flange arranged at the two ends of the pipeline clamp; the first flange is used for fixing the to-be-welded flange; the clamp is arranged on the bracket in a sleeved manner; the short pipe pipeline is arranged on the first rotary plate; and the second flange is in tight fit to the second rotary plate, and the second flange rotates along with the second rotary plate. The welding positioning device is simple in structure, is convenient to manufacture, is convenient to rotate and is convenient to weld, realizes relative positioning between the to-be-welded short pipe pipeline and the flange, improves the working efficiency and ensures the welding quality.

Specific embodiment
The invention will be further described below in conjunction with the accompanying drawings.Following examples are only used for clearly illustrating the present invention Technical scheme, and can not be limited the scope of the invention with this.
First embodiment:
As Figure 1-3, a kind of apparatus for welding and positioning for short tube flange, including support and the folder being arranged on support Tool, supporting structure is as shown in figure 1, including pedestal 1, pedestal 1 is provided with perpendicular rotating shaft 2, in rotating shaft 2 from top to bottom successively It is provided with the first rotating disk 3 for positioning short tube pipeline 10 to be welded and the second rotating disk 4 for positioning fixture, the first rotating disk 3 Can be with the synchronous axial system of rotating shaft 2 with the second rotating disk 4, and height in rotating shaft 2 can be adjusted, to adapt to the pipe of different length Road, is circumferentially uniformly provided with some fixture pilot pins or fixture positioning hole on the second rotating disk 4, for by fixture and the second rotating disk 4 It is fixed together.
Clamp structure is as shown in Fig. 2 including for clamping the pipeline jig 5 of short tube pipeline 10 and being arranged on pipeline jig 5 The first flange 6 and second flange 7 at two ends, pipeline jig 5, first flange 6 are arranged concentrically and are fixedly connected with second flange 7, Fixture is set on support, and the first rotating disk 3 stretches into the inside of pipeline jig 5, and short tube pipeline 10 to be welded is placed in the first rotating disk 3 On, second flange 7 is brought into close contact with the second rotating disk 4, by the fixture pilot pin or fixture positioning hole that are arranged on the second rotating disk 4 It is fixedly connected with the second rotating disk 4 and is rotated with the second rotating disk 4.First flange 6 is used to fix acting flange to be welded 20, the first method Even circumferential is provided with some flange pilot pins or flange location hole on blue 6, for fixing acting flange to be welded 20.Fixture is pressed from both sides along pipeline The diameter of tool 5 is divided into the first fixture and the second fixture, and the first fixture and the second fixture are linked together by fixture attachment means. Fixture attachment means are iron ear 8, and iron ear 8 is arranged on the joint in the middle part of the first fixture and the second fixture, and iron ear 8 is provided with some Through hole, is bolted through hole and the first fixture and the second fixture is fixed together, and realizes to short tube pipeline 10 to be welded Grip.
When using, short tube pipeline 10 to be welded is vertically placed on the first rotating disk 3 of support, fixture is set in short tube On pipeline 10, after regulating height, the second flange of fixture is fixed with the second rotating disk 4 of support, tightens bolt, and clamp is short Pipeline 10, flange 20 to be welded is fixed in the first flange 10 of fixture, short tube pipeline 10 to be welded afterwards and method Blue 20 can rotate together with fixture, convenient welding.
Apparatus for welding and positioning for short tube flange of the invention, by the short tube pipeline that rotating shaft and driven by rotary disc are to be welded 10 rotate, and then drive flange to be welded 20 to rotate together by fixture, realize the phase of short tube pipeline to be welded and flange To positioning, and position location reliability, convenient rotation is easy to welding, and then improve operating efficiency, it is ensured that welding quality, Extend the service life of finished product.
